Land Market Insights and Pricing in Catron County, New Mexico
On average, land listings in Catron County, NM have a lot size of 563 acres and are priced around $473,629. The median price per acre in Catron County, NM is $2,753.

About Catron County, NM
Catron County, New Mexico's largest county, offers vast expanses of land across nearly 7,000 square miles of mountainous terrain and forested areas. Home to parts of three national forests - Gila, Apache, and Cibola - the region boasts abundant wildlife, with an elk population far exceeding its human residents. The landscape features unique geological wonders like the Red Hill Volcanic Field and Plains of San Agustin. With a property tax rate of 0.34%, significantly below the national average, Catron presents attractive opportunities for land buyers. However, the county faces economic challenges, including higher unemployment and lower median earnings compared to national figures. Despite these, Catron's natural beauty, including the Catwalk National Recreation Trail and ancient Native American sites, makes it an intriguing destination for outdoor enthusiasts and history buffs alike.
